RSU 4 board passes budget 5-1

WALES — The Regional School Unit 4 board Wednesday approved an $18.9 million budget for fiscal year 2016-17, an increase of $341,000 from this year’s budget. Selectmen approve 40 warrant articles to be presented May 19

SABATTUS — The Board of Selectmen approved 40 warrant articles for fiscal year 2016-2017 to be presented at town meeting on Thursday, May 19.
